30 novembre 198027 minCrooked antique expert Cyril Boggis dresses as a vicar and calls on Suffolk farmsteads offering to take old furniture off the occupants' hands for a fee. Of course, he knows when the furniture is valuable and none more so than the dresser he sees at Farmer Rummins' run-down place. So as not to create suspicion he tells Rummins that he is only interested in the legs.Ce titre n'est pas disponible en raison de droits expirésS. 3 ÉP. 7 - The Stinker
